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of a metal print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 1/16" thick aluminum.
The aluminum sheet is offset from the wall by a 3/4" thick wooden frame which is attached to the back. The wooden frame includes a hanging wire for easy mounting on your wall (see photo on the left).
All metal prints ship within 3 - 4 business days and arrive "ready to hang" with mounting hooks and nails.
Metal prints are extremely durable. They're lightweight. They won't bend, and they're water resistant.
The high gloss of the aluminum s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.

Artist's Description
This was taken in Madrid (pronounced MADrid), New Mexico. In the 70's hippies settled here and some remained. What captivated me about this scene were the mailboxes, which appeared to be imbued with their own personalities and tell us much about the people who live in this town. Vehicles are parked in front of the No Parking sign. Are they still a little anti-establishment?
Madrid, New Mexico is actually part of Santa Fe County. It had been an old mining town and then turned into a ghost town. It is now an artist community located on the Turquois Trail.
